What are the Calendly brand color codes?

The Calendly colors are Blue Ribbon, Bright Turquoise, White, Congress Blue. The Calendly brand color codes in HEX, RGB, CMYK, and Pantone formats can be found below. The following table provides standardized color codes across multiple systems, including HEX, RGB, and CMYK, along with Pantone (PMS), RAL, and NCS (Natural Color System). HEX and RGB formats are specifically intended for digital applications such as web design and user interfaces, while CMYK values are optimized for professional printing purposes.

The Calendly brand colors are Blue Ribbon, Bright Turquoise, White, Congress Blue. The Blue Ribbon color code for the brand is HEX: #006BFF, RGB: 0, 107, 255, CMYK: 100, 58, 0, 0.  The Bright Turquoise color code for the brand is HEX: #0AE8F0, RGB: 10, 232, 240, CMYK: 96, 3, 0, 6.  The White color code for the brand is HEX: #FFFFFF, RGB: 255, 255, 255, CMYK: 0, 0, 0, 0.  The Congress Blue color code for the brand is HEX: #004796, RGB: 0, 71, 150, CMYK: 100, 53, 0, 41.
